Alright, buckle up, music fanatics, because Dethlord isn't just dropping an EP; they're detonating a sonic statement with SAD! This isn't just music; it's a raw, unfiltered journey into the darkest corners of the digital psyche, delivered with the visceral punch only our A.I. overlords at Dethlord Productions and So Litty Records could conjure.
Forget your typical "sad boy" anthems or mopey indie rock. The SAD! EP is a full-throttle assault on tranquility, a meticulously crafted chaos that taps into the zeitgeist of modern anxiety, digital overload, and the sheer, unadulterated rage lurking beneath our curated online personas.
From the moment "You're Too Angry and Manic" rips through your speakers, you're not just listening; you're experiencing it. The track isn't a whisper of discontent; it's a primal scream against the internal cacophony that many of us feel. It's the sound of a thousand unread notifications, political outrage, and personal insecurities collapsing into a singular, explosive moment. It's the soundtrack to your feed melting down, a perfect companion for anyone who's ever wanted to throw their phone into the abyss.
Then comes "Blueprints (To Disaster)," a track that feels like the insidious hum of a malevolent algorithm plotting your downfall. There's a sinister beauty in its construction, a metallic grind that would make Trent Reznor proud, if Trent Reznor were composing from the depths of a server farm gone rogue. This isn't just a song; it's the schema for your worst day, an industrial ballet of impending doom.
And let's talk about "I Hate You, I Hate You, I Hate You." This isn't just a title; it's a mantra, a cathartic release of every petty grievance, every betrayal, every moment of sheer frustration that boils under the surface. It’s the furious energy of a thousand angry tweets compressed into three minutes of pure, unadulterated vitriol. It echoes the raw, unpolished aggression of early 2000s nu-metal but with a chilling, almost synthetic precision. This is the track you put on when you need to scream into the void, but Dethlord does the screaming for you.
The titular track, "Sad," strips back the layers, not to find solace, but to expose a chilling emptiness. It's brief, poignant, and hits like a sudden realization in the middle of a mosh pit—a moment of stark, digital despair. It’s the quiet after the storm, not of peace, but of utter desolation, perfectly capturing that hollow ache when the anger finally subsides, leaving only the void.
But Dethlord is never just sad. "It's Not That Serious" brings back the heavy, almost sarcastic detachment that defines the A.I. persona. It's the digital shrug, the dismissive wave, the perfectly calibrated apathy of a system that understands human drama but refuses to be consumed by it. There’s a delicious irony here, a track so intensely serious about its lack of seriousness.
Finally, "Freak Out" closes the EP with a return to the chaotic energy, a final, unhinged burst that reminds us this journey was never meant to be comfortable. It’s the sound of liberation through pure, unfiltered abandon, a frantic, glorious explosion that leaves you both exhilarated and utterly drained.
